Illinois appellate court says CAFO owner entitled to damages

Ok, most people reading this blog probably will not be happy to see this, but in the spirit of keeping up with legal rulings whether or not you agree with them comes this one from Illinois:

A Rochester hog farmer is entitled to damages stemming from a lawsuit filed by opponents of his large-scale hog operation that delayed its construction, the Illinois 4th District Appellate Court decided this week.
